Checking the fuel system





Caution! Fuel is extremely flammable, so take special precautions when working on any part of the fuel system. Do not smoke or use open flames or portable electric lighting devices that are not equipped with protective screens. Do not work in a garage that uses gas-powered equipment, such as a water heater or clothes dryer. Since fuel is carcinogenic, wear protective gloves when working to avoid contact with the fuel on your hands. If fuel comes into contact with your skin, wash it off immediately with soap and water. Any fuel spilled on the floor must be wiped up immediately. Do not store contaminated rags left over from working with fuel in areas where ignition is possible. The fuel system maintains constant pressure. If you are going to disconnect any part of the fuel system, you must first relieve the pressure. When performing any work on the fuel system, wear safety glasses or a mask and keep a fire extinguisher handy.


1. If you smell gasoline while driving or after the car has been in the sun for some time, the fuel system should be checked immediately.

2. Remove the gas cap and inspect it for damage and rust. Check the condition of the gasket. If it shows signs of rust or is damaged, replace it (see Figure 16.2).



Figure 16.2. Using a small screwdriver, carefully pry up the old seal, being careful not to damage the cover.


3. Check for cracks in the fuel lines connecting the fuel tank to the injection system. Check the tightness of the flare nuts on the fuel line connections and, on pre-2000 models, the tightness of the banjo bolt in the fuel filter nipple connection.

4. To inspect the fuel lines and tank, it is best to place the car on a lift. If a lift is not available, set the parking brake, raise the front of the vehicle with a jack and place safety stands.

5. Inspect the gas tank and filler neck; there should be no cracks, holes, etc. The rubber filler neck may leak due to decomposition of the rubber or wear (see Figure 16.5), for example, from overtightened or loose clamps.



Figure 16.5. Check the rubber gas tank filler neck for cracks and make sure the clamps are tight.


A car owner can fix these problems on his own.

Warning! Do not attempt to repair the gas tank under any circumstances (except for replacing its rubber components).


6. Check all rubber hoses and metal pipes for loose connections, fasteners, damage, pinching, etc.
